Understanding Bursitis and Why Inflammation Persists

Bursitis develops when bursae—the small sacs that cushion joints and reduce friction—become irritated or inflamed. Common triggers include repetitive motions, overuse during sports or work, sudden injury, or underlying conditions such as arthritis. The hips and shoulders are frequent sites because these large, mobile joints endure significant mechanical stress.

Inflammation in the bursa leads to pain, swelling, and restricted movement that can interfere with daily activities, sleep, and exercise. Conventional management often involves rest, ice, anti-inflammatory medications, or in some cases corticosteroid injections or physical therapy. Many individuals seek additional non-invasive tools that can be used at home without ongoing reliance on medication.

Red light therapy, also known as photobiomodulation, has gained attention for its potential to support cellular energy production and modulate inflammatory responses. The wavelengths typically used—around 660 nm red light and 850 nm near-infrared—can penetrate skin and soft tissue to reach the bursa area. This may help reduce perceived inflammation and discomfort in mild to moderate cases, though individual results vary based on the cause and severity of the bursitis.

According to general photobiomodulation principles, light in these ranges can influence mitochondrial function, which may contribute to faster tissue recovery in some users. However, red light therapy works best as a supportive measure rather than a standalone fix, especially when symptoms have a mechanical or systemic component.

How Red Light Therapy May Help with Bursitis Symptoms

The proposed mechanism centers on the ability of red and near-infrared light to reach deeper tissues without generating excessive heat. For bursitis, this penetration can target the inflamed bursa and adjacent muscles or tendons, potentially improving local circulation and supporting the body's natural resolution of inflammation.

Studies and clinical reviews on related joint conditions, such as arthritis and tendonitis, suggest that consistent photobiomodulation may help reduce pain and stiffness. While direct large-scale trials specifically on bursitis remain limited, the overlapping biology of joint inflammation makes it a reasonable area of interest for at-home use.

Users often report that regular sessions feel soothing and may contribute to gradual improvement in mobility when combined with proper rest and activity modification. The effect is generally considered cumulative, meaning consistency over weeks tends to matter more than any single session.

It is important to maintain realistic expectations. Red light therapy does not address structural issues like bone spurs or severe tears, nor does it treat infectious bursitis. Always consult a healthcare professional if you experience fever, significant redness, rapid swelling, or pain that prevents normal movement.

Hip Bursitis vs Shoulder Bursitis: Practical Differences in Application

The location of bursitis affects how easily you can apply red light therapy at home. Shoulder bursitis is often more straightforward to treat because the area is accessible and can be targeted directly with a panel, belt, or smaller device while seated or standing. Hip bursitis, by contrast, involves deeper tissues around the greater trochanter, and positioning can be more challenging—requiring you to lie on your side or use a larger coverage device for consistent exposure.

This practical difference influences device choice and session comfort. For shoulders, shorter sessions with a focused panel or belt often suffice. For hips, a full-body mat or a high-coverage panel may provide more reliable delivery to the affected area without constant readjustment.

Choosing an Effective Device for Joint Inflammation

Not all red light devices deliver the same therapeutic potential. For bursitis, experts often recommend devices with irradiance above 100 mW/cm² at treatment distance to ensure adequate energy reaches the target tissue within reasonable session times. Look for products that specify irradiance using proper measurement methods rather than inflated marketing numbers.

Wavelength combination matters too. A mix of 660 nm red light for more superficial effects and 850 nm near-infrared for deeper penetration is commonly used for joint support. Safety features such as low EMF output and compliance with relevant standards add confidence for regular home use.

Building a Safe At-Home Routine

A practical routine for bursitis typically involves sessions of 10 to 20 minutes, performed three to five times per week. Position the device so the light reaches the painful area directly, maintaining the recommended treatment distance specified by the manufacturer.

For shoulder bursitis, sitting or standing in front of a panel or wrapping a therapy belt around the joint works well. For hip bursitis, lying on your side on a mat or using a large panel while carefully supported can improve coverage. Clean skin and removal of clothing or thick bandages in the treatment area help maximize light penetration.

Start with shorter sessions to assess tolerance, then gradually increase duration and frequency as comfort allows. Many users incorporate red light therapy into their evening wind-down routine or post-activity recovery window. Tracking your sessions in a simple journal can help you notice patterns in pain levels and mobility over time.

Combine red light therapy with other conservative measures such as gentle stretching, proper posture, activity modification, and adequate sleep. If you are already under medical care, discuss your home routine with your provider to ensure it complements their recommendations.

Setting Realistic Expectations and Knowing When to Seek Professional Help

Results from red light therapy for bursitis tend to appear gradually rather than overnight. Some individuals notice reduced stiffness and easier movement within a few weeks of consistent use, while others experience more subtle benefits focused on comfort during daily activities. Factors such as the underlying cause of bursitis, overall health, and adherence to the routine all influence outcomes.

Do not purchase or rely on red light therapy if your symptoms suggest a more serious issue. Seek medical evaluation promptly if you have severe pain, marked swelling that is increasing, redness or warmth suggesting infection, fever, or significant loss of joint function. These signs may indicate septic bursitis or another condition requiring different intervention.
